2. Fundamental Concepts: How Creativity Shapes Game Mechanics
At the core of engaging game design lies inventive mechanics—rules and systems that determine how players interact with the game world. Creativity fuels the development of these mechanics, resulting in experiences that are both familiar and refreshingly novel.
The role of inventive mechanics in engaging players
Innovative mechanics challenge players to think differently, encouraging exploration, strategic planning, and problem-solving. For example, traditional platformers relied on jumping and obstacle avoidance, but modern titles incorporate physics-based puzzles or multi-layered decision trees that deepen engagement.
Examples of traditional vs. innovative game features
| Traditional Features | Innovative Features |
|---|---|
| Turn-based combat | Real-time strategy with adaptive AI |
| Linear storytelling | Branching narratives with player choices |
| Fixed game rules | Procedural content generation |
The influence of technological advancements on creative possibilities
Technological progress—such as high-fidelity graphics, motion capture, and cloud computing—enables developers to implement more sophisticated and creative mechanics. For instance, virtual reality creates fully immersive environments, allowing for innovative gameplay that was previously impossible. These advancements continually expand the horizon of human creativity in gaming.
